Manohar Aich, also known as "Pocket Hercules," was a legendary figure in the world of bodybuilding.
Born on March 17, 1912, in the Comilla district (which was then part of British India and is now Bangladesh), India, Aich's journey to becoming a bodybuilding icon was filled with challenges and obstacles.
However, his determination and passion for physical fitness propelled him to great heights, making him a source of inspiration for aspiring bodybuilders around the world.
Aich's legacy in Indian bodybuilding cannot be overstated. He was the first Indian to win the Mr. Universe title in 1952, putting India on the map in the world of bodybuilding.
His achievements paved the way for future generations of Indian bodybuilders and inspired countless individuals to pursue their dreams in the field of fitness and bodybuilding.

Manohar Aich's Early Life and Background
Manohar Aich was born into a humble family in the Comilla district. Growing up in poverty, he faced numerous challenges from an early age. However, Aich's interest in physical fitness and bodybuilding began to develop during his childhood. He was fascinated by the strength and physique of circus performers and wrestlers, which sparked his desire to build a strong and muscular body.
Despite his passion for bodybuilding, Aich faced many obstacles due to his financial circumstances. He did not have access to proper training facilities or equipment, forcing him to rely on his own creativity and resourcefulness. Aich would often use homemade weights made from concrete-filled buckets and train in public parks or on the rooftops of buildings.
Manohar Aich's Rise to Fame in Bodybuilding
Aich's entry into competitive bodybuilding came in the late 1940s when he participated in local contests in Kolkata. His dedication and hard work paid off when he won his first major title at the Mr. Hercules contest in 1950. This victory propelled him into the national spotlight and marked the beginning of his rise to fame in the world of bodybuilding.
Aich's success continued at both national and international competitions. He won the Mr. Universe title in the amateur category of the NABBA Universe Championships 1952, becoming the first Indian to achieve this prestigious honor. Aich's victory was a groundbreaking moment for Indian bodybuilding and brought international recognition to his talent and dedication.
Manohar Aich's Physical Stats: Age, Height, and Weight
Throughout his career, Manohar Aich maintained an impressive physique despite his relatively small stature. Standing at just 4 feet 11 inches tall, he weighed around 139 pounds during his prime. Aich's compact frame and muscular build earned him the nickname "Pocket Hercules," highlighting his incredible strength and power.
Compared to other bodybuilders of his time, Aich's physical stats were considered exceptional. While many bodybuilders focused on bulking up and increasing their size, Aich prioritized symmetry and proportion in his physique. His well-defined muscles and balanced proportions set him apart from his competitors and contributed to his success in the sport.

Manohar Aich's Net Worth and Financial Status
While Manohar Aich achieved great success in bodybuilding, his financial status remained modest throughout his life. Bodybuilding was not as lucrative a profession during his time as it is today, and Aich relied on various sources of income to support himself and his family. He worked as a physical education instructor and later opened his own gym to supplement his earnings from competitions.
Compared to other bodybuilders of his time, Aich's net worth was relatively modest. However, his impact on the sport and his legacy far outweighed any financial considerations.
